12 Month Contract | Bristol | Hybrid | 4 Days in the office
We're looking for an experienced Finance Manager to join a leading organisation on a 12 month contract. This is an excellent opportunity for a qualified accountant who thrives in a transformational environment and enjoys driving change, improving processes and leading high-performing teams.
The client is willing to consider FTC or Daily Rate.
This is far more than a traditional finance role. You'll play a key part in modernising the finance function, delivering continuous improvement initiatives and implementing smarter, more efficient ways of working, while partnering closely with senior operational leaders.
The Role- Lead and develop a team, creating a high-performing, commercially focused finance function.
- Drive finance transformation projects, identifying opportunities to improve processes, standardise ways of working and increase automation.
- Lead change initiatives across the finance function, ensuring successful implementation and stakeholder engagement.
- Support the transition of finance activities into a Shared Service Centre, improving efficiency and consistency.
- Utilise Microsoft 365 tools, including Power BI, Power Automate and SharePoint, to enhance reporting and reduce manual processes.
- Own budgeting, forecasting and cost control, providing commercial insight and robust financial challenge.
- Deliver accurate month-end reporting, KPI dashboards and management information to support business performance.
- Partner with operational leaders to improve financial understanding, drive accountability and support strategic decision-making.
- Ensure strong financial controls, governance and compliance are maintained.
Ideally you'll be a qualified accountant (ACA, ACCA or CIMA) with experience leading finance teams and delivering meaningful change.
You'll also have:
- A proven track record of finance transformation, process improvement and implementing change.
- Experience driving automation, standardisation and continuous improvement within finance.
- Strong stakeholder management and business partnering skills.
- Advanced Microsoft 365 skills, including Excel, Power BI, Power Automate and SharePoint.
- Excellent analytical, commercial and problem-solving abilities.
- The ability to influence at all levels and man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ment.
